Beyond immediate relief, professional care focuses on permanent solutions for recurring nail issues. If the nail continues to grow into the flesh despite conservative management, the clinician may recommend a minor surgical procedure known as a partial nail avulsion. During this process, the specialist removes a narrow strip of the nail and applies a chemical agent to the root to prevent that specific section from regrowing. Preventing Complications and Long-term Recurrence
Ignoring a painful nail can lead to the formation of hypergranulation tissue, which is a fleshy overgrowth that bleeds easily and signals a chronic inflammatory response. For individuals with underlying health conditions like diabetes or poor circulation, an untreated ingrown toenail in Singapore poses a significant risk of developing deep-seated infections or foot ulcers. Education is crucial in preventing future nail problems, as many cases stem from avoidable habits. A specialist will examine your footwear to ensure the toe box provides enough room and will demonstrate the straight across cutting technique that prevents sharp corners from digging into the skin. 5 Crucial Benefits of Seeking Professional Treatment
- Sterile Environment – Procedures occur in a controlled setting to eliminate the risk of cross-contamination and hospital-acquired infections.
- Specialised Instrumentation – Podiatrists use fine-tipped nippers and elevators designed specifically for the delicate anatomy of the nail fold.
- Pain Management – Access to local anaesthetics ensures that even deep nail impactions receive treatment without causing significant distress to the patient.
- Accurate Diagnosis – Professionals can distinguish between an ingrown nail and other conditions, such as subungual exostosis or fungal infections.
- Customised Orthotics – If gait issues cause the nail problem, a podiatrist can prescribe insoles to redistribute pressure away from the toes.
